Cost of Living Comparison Between Philadelphia, PA and Aalborg Cost of Living Comparison Between Philadelphia, PA and Aalborg

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$2,970 per month in Philadelphia, PA vs $2,275 in Aalborg, rent included.

A couple spends around $4,338 per month in Philadelphia, PA vs $3,523 in Aalborg, rent included.

A family of three spends $5,707 per month in Philadelphia, PA vs $4,770 in Aalborg, rent included.

Philadelphia, PA costs about 31% more than Aalborg,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Both Philadelphia, PA and Aalborg sit above the global median – Philadelphia, PA by 122%, Aalborg by 70%.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$1,780 in Philadelphia, PA versus $902 in Aalborg.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 6% higher in Aalborg,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$89.0 in Philadelphia, PA versus $109 in Aalborg. Groceries tell a different story – $490 in Philadelphia, PA vs $432 in Aalborg – so Aalborg w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
